CSS左邊對(duì)齊后居中技巧分享
在CSS中,實(shí)現(xiàn)左邊對(duì)齊后居中的效果,需要利用一些關(guān)鍵技巧和屬性,以下是一些實(shí)現(xiàn)這一效果的方法:
1、使用flexbox布局
Flexbox布局是一種非常靈活的布局方式,可以輕松地實(shí)現(xiàn)左邊對(duì)齊后居中的效果,通過(guò)設(shè)定容器的display屬性為flex,并設(shè)置justify-content為space-between,可以讓子元素在容器中左邊對(duì)齊,并且剩余空間在子元素之間平均分配,從而實(shí)現(xiàn)居中效果。
2、利用grid布局
Grid布局也是實(shí)現(xiàn)左邊對(duì)齊后居中的好選擇,通過(guò)設(shè)定容器的display屬性為grid,并設(shè)置justify-content為space-between,可以讓子元素在容器中左邊對(duì)齊,并且剩余空間在子元素之間平均分配,從而實(shí)現(xiàn)居中效果。
3、使用position屬性
通過(guò)設(shè)定子元素的position屬性為absolute,并設(shè)置left屬性為0,可以將子元素固定在容器的左側(cè),通過(guò)設(shè)定子元素的margin屬性,可以調(diào)整子元素與容器邊緣的距離,從而實(shí)現(xiàn)居中效果。
4、利用transform屬性
通過(guò)設(shè)定子元素的transform屬性為translateX(-50%),可以將子元素向左移動(dòng)50%的寬度,從而實(shí)現(xiàn)左邊對(duì)齊的效果,通過(guò)設(shè)定子元素的margin屬性,可以調(diào)整子元素與容器邊緣的距離,從而實(shí)現(xiàn)居中效果。
是幾種實(shí)現(xiàn)CSS左邊對(duì)齊后居中效果的方法,在實(shí)際應(yīng)用中,可以根據(jù)具體的需求和場(chǎng)景選擇適合的方法,也需要注意一些細(xì)節(jié)和注意事項(xiàng),如設(shè)置容器的寬度和高度、子元素的寬度和高度等,以確保效果的準(zhǔn)確性和穩(wěn)定性。